Senior Product Manager - My Account & User Management (m/f/d)

At Statista, we’re all about facts and data, for we are the world's leading business data platform. By providing reliable and easy-to-use data as well as various data analytics products and services, we empower people worldwide to make fact-based decisions.

Founded in Hamburg in 2007, we have quickly grown into a global company with offices in major cities such as London, New York, Berlin and Tokyo. And we still have a lot of plans. Our constant growth does not only prove our success, but also keeps creating new development and career opportunities for our employees.

We value and celebrate our diverse culture. You are welcome here for who you are, no matter where you come from, what you look like, or whether you prefer bar graphs to pie charts. Your story matters – keep writing it as part of our team.

Are you ready to join us?

 What you’ll do:

As Senior Product Manager “My Account & User Management” you will play a key role in enabling our go-to-market strategy by automating manual work and moving from human touch to tech touch—unlocking growth and efficiency while increasing customer satisfaction at the same time. 

  • Own and drive the product roadmap and execution to evolve our “My Account” space into a smart, customer-centric self-service hub that scales with our ambitions.  

  • Empower customers to manage their subscription, licenses, payment data and preference settings with ease, while enabling internal teams with intuitive internal interfaces to efficiently manage user accounts, customer data, and permissions. 

  • Define and execute strategies around user data, roles and permissions as well as access levels to ensure smooth self-service and access provisioning.  

  • Drive process optimizations by automations and further enhancing customer self-serve features with standard solutions or seeking innovation with emerging technologies like AI Agents. 

  • Enable other product teams to integrate their features (favorites, history, newsletters, etc.) into the self-service hub to enhance customer engagement. 

  • Evolve our central user database, ensuring secure and scalable data access across teams while aligning with regulations and taking care of protecting both user privacy rights and business interests. 

 

Who you are: 

With a strong background in product management in B2B digital subscription business, you thrive on complex challenges and enjoy working in a mission-driven environment.  

  • 5+ year in product management in B2B SaaS or digital subscription business– with profound experience with self-service portals, user account management or subscription management features. 

  • Experienced with optimizing workflows through automation or with e.g. Chatbots, AI agents to create value for (external and internal) customers with seamless user journeys. 

  • Structured, process-driven thinker with a customer-centric mind-set and solid business understanding. 

  • Valued team-player and skilled in aligning cross-functional teams and managing diverse stakeholders (such as Client Success and Finance). 

  • Proven track record in agile product development (e.g. Scrum), data-driven decision making.  

  • Experienced in balancing strategic feature development with tech debt management to drive sustainable product evolution. 

The team: 

You’ll join a newly formed, but highly skilled and motivated Product Engineering team with an Engineering Manager as your counterpart. Reporting to the Director Product Revenue, you’ll work closely with other product managers, engineers, designers, and data experts who are passionate about experimenting, innovating, and driving our product mission of enabling people with trusted data.
